How many state senators are there in the state of Michigan?

Each state has 2 senators in the US Senate. (see the related link below) *The Michigan Legislature consists of a 38-member Senate and 110-member House of Representatives. Senators serve four-year terms and Representatives two.

How many representative's does Michigan in the senate?

Michigan, like every other state, has 2 Senators representing the state in Congress.


Who represents the people in the Senate?

Senators represent the people in the Senate. Each Senator represents between 1 and 37 million people depending on their state's population.
